Crystal Structure of Inosine 5'-monophosphate Dehydrogenase from Clostridium perfringens Complexed with IMP and P221 Descriptor: (4R)-2-METHYLPENTANE-2,4-DIOL, (4S)-2-METHYL-2,4-PENTANEDIOL, ACETIC ACID, ... Authors: Maltseva, N, Kim, Y, Mulligan, R, Makowska-Grzyska, M, Gu, M, Gollapalli, D.R, Hedstrom, L, Joachimiak, A, Anderson, W.F, Center for Structural Genomics of Infectious Diseases (CSGID) Deposit date: 2017-02-26 Release date: 2017-03-22 Last modified: 2026-03-25 Method: X-RAY DIFFRACTION (1.85 Å) Cite: Role of the Mobile Active Site Flap in IMP Dehydrogenase Inhibitor Binding. Acs Infect Dis., 11, 2025
